What Does Slight Inferior Repolarization Disturbance In An ECG Indicate?

I have had two ECG in a matter of a month one a s a regular check up and the other for a medical clearance to have a surgery to remove my testes. One says Anterior infarct, R The second one today says Slight inferior repolarixation distrubance, consider ischemia, LV overload or aspecific change, small negative T in aVF with negativeT in lll Borderline ECG

Hello,

Don't consider the machine interpretation. It may be wrong. Please post the rhythm strip or show it to a physician he will examine and treat you accordingly.
